Navigating Depression: A Guide to Therapy

Wiki Article

Depression may feel like an overwhelming obstacle. It stifles your thoughts and fills you of energy. Luckily, there are effective ways to cope with this complex condition, and therapy is often a vital component.

Seeking therapy isn't a sign of weakness; it's a meaningful step towards wellness. A skilled therapist provides a supportive space to explore your feelings, cultivate coping mechanisms, and learn strategies for navigating its impact on your life.

Finding the right therapist is crucial. Look for someone who works with depression and with whom you feel comfortable opening up your experiences.

ul

li C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T) can be particularly helpful in recognizing negative thought patterns and replacing them with more constructive ones.

li Dialectical behavior therapy (DBT) provides skills for controlling emotions, enhancing interpersonal relationships, and increasing mindfulness.

li Psychodynamic therapy explores past experiences and hidden patterns that could be affecting your current depression.

Remember, you're not alone in this battle. Therapy can be a transformative experience that empowers you toward well-being.

Breaking Free from Depression: Tools and Techniques for Healing

Depression can feel like an insurmountable wall, obscuring your ability to see the light. But remember, you are not alone in this struggle, and healing is possible. There are powerful tools available to help you break free from the grip of depression and rediscover joy in life.

One vital step is strengthening a supportive network. Connecting with loved ones, joining support groups, or seeking professional counseling can provide invaluable comfort and encouragement.

Participating yourself in activities that bring you joy, even if it's just for short periods, can help shift your mindset and boost your spirits. This could involve exploring new hobbies, spending time in nature, or reconnecting with old passions.

Prioritizing self-care is also essential. Make sure you are getting enough shuteye, eating nutritious meals, and engaging in regular physical motion. These seemingly small actions can have a profound impact on your overall well-being.

Remember, healing from depression is a journey, not a destination. Be patient with yourself, celebrate small victories, and never hesitate to reach out for help when you need it.

Therapy as a Lifeline: Supporting Mental Health and Combating Depression

In today's tumultuous world, prioritizing mental well-being is more crucial than ever. For many individuals struggling with depression, therapy can serve as a true lifeline, offering a safe and supportive space to explore their feelings, develop coping mechanisms, and ultimately thrive. A skilled therapist can assist clients in navigating the complexities of mental health, providing valuable tools and insights to improve their overall well-being.

Through various therapeutic approaches, such as c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T) or mindfulness-based therapies, individuals can learn to challenge negative thought patterns, regulate emotional responses, and cultivate a greater sense of self-awareness. Therapy is not a sign of weakness but rather a courageous step towards growth. By seeking professional help, individuals can unlock their resilience and embark on a journey of lasting mental health.
